.dt-wrapper{width:100%;max-width:1200px;margin:auto;padding:40px 20px;font-family:system-ui,-apple-system,Segoe UI,Roboto,Arial}.dt-header,.dt-footer{text-align:center;margin:10px 0 18px}.dt-main-title{font-size:42px;font-weight:900;letter-spacing:2px;color:#1a1a4b;display:block;margin-bottom:10px}.dt-swiper{height:1280px}@media(max-width:768px){.dt-swiper{height:920px}}.dt-arrow-btn{width:54px;height:54px;border-radius:50%;background:#fff;margin:0 auto;display:flex;align-items:center;justify-content:center;cursor:pointer;box-shadow:0 12px 28px rgb(0 0 0 / .14)}.dt-arrow-btn span{width:12px;height:12px;border-right:3px solid #1a1a4b;border-bottom:3px solid #1a1a4b}.dt-arrow-prev span{transform:rotate(-135deg)}.dt-arrow-next span{transform:rotate(45deg)}.dt-card{position:relative;height:100%;border-radius:28px;overflow:hidden;background-size:cover;background-position:center;display:flex;align-items:center;justify-content:center;flex-direction:column}.dt-card::before{content:"";position:absolute;inset:0;background:#00000080}.dt-pill{padding:18px 44px;border-radius:0 0 18px 18px;font-weight:900;letter-spacing:1px;font-size:36px;color:#fff;box-shadow:0 12px 28px rgb(0 0 0 / .14);z-index:2;text-align:center;line-height:1;font-family:var(--e-global-typography-primary-font-family),Sans-serif}.dt-btn{margin-bottom:30px;background:#fff;padding:12px 26px;border-radius:999px;font-weight:600;text-decoration:none;color:#111;z-index:2;box-shadow:0 10px 25px rgb(0 0 0 / .14)}